Hyderabad: Minister Jupally Krishnarao alerted the district collectors of the unified Adilabad region on Wednesday as heavy rainfall continued to batter northern Telangana.
He held phone discussions with the collectors of Adilabad, Asifabad, Nirmal, and Mancherial districts, seeking updates on the rainfall intensity and prevailing flood conditions. He asked which areas had received the highest rainfall and whether low-lying zones were at risk.
Adilabad rain alert prompts flood watch and fertiliser supply checks
The minister instructed the officials to keep ground-level staff available and issue alerts to residents in vulnerable areas. He emphasized the need for full preparedness in case rainfall intensified further.
In addition to the flood response, Krishnarao also reviewed urea distribution for farmers. He asked if there were any shortages and told collectors to monitor both government and private fertiliser outlets regularly. He directed them to ensure uninterrupted supply and prevent hoarding.
